Transaction edc20ae61efb3f783f4afefa7444eca3955e1cbdf40765f337016ac14df3d3b1

block
00078f1564aa473a68e81085572ff4289d116ecd2738e70c5f99af6915d9e16b

1 Input

23 Outputs